About the Role
Our client, a leader in zero-emission transportation solutions and advanced electric bus manufacturing, is seeking a highly skilled Controller to oversee the financial operations of its Pasadena location. This role is pivotal in driving financial accuracy, enhancing internal controls, and supporting strategic decision-making for a rapidly growing clean-tech organization.
The Controller will lead core accounting functions, ensure compliance with GAAP, manage financial reporting, and partner with executive leadership to support operational and manufacturing initiatives.

Key Responsibilities
Financial Management & Reporting
Oversee all daily accounting operations including AP/AR, GL, payroll, and cost accounting.
Prepare accurate monthly, quarterly, and year-end financial statements in accordance with GAAP.
Develop internal management reports, KPIs, and dashboards for executive leadership.
Lead month-end and year-end close processes, ensuring timeliness and accuracy.
Budgeting & Forecasting
Lead annual budgeting processes and ongoing financial forecasts.
Conduct variance analyses and provide actionable insights to operations, supply chain, and leadership teams.
Identify opportunities to improve financial performance and operational efficiency.
Cost Accounting & Manufacturing Finance
Oversee cost accounting for vehicle manufacturing and assembly operations.
Maintain BOM accuracy, inventory valuation, and labor/overhead allocations.
Support product costing initiatives and margin improvement projects.
Internal Controls & Compliance
Strengthen and maintain internal controls, accounting policies, and financial procedures.
Work closely with auditors during external and internal audit processes.
Ensure compliance with tax requirements and regulatory obligations.
Leadership & Collaboration
Manage and develop a small but high-performing accounting team.
Partner with operations, supply chain, procurement, and HR on cross-functional initiatives.
Support ERP improvements and data integrity across systems.

Qualifications
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ance, or related field required.
CPA or CMA strongly preferred.
7+ years of progressive accounting experience, including manufacturing or industrial experience.
Strong knowledge of GAAP, cost accounting, and inventory accounting.
Experience with ERP systems (SAP, Oracle, NetSuite, or similar).
Excellent analytical skills, attention to detail, and leadership capabilities.
Ability to thrive in a fast-paced, evolving environment.

What We Do

GHJ is an accounting and advisory firm that specializes in nonprofit, food and beverage, entertainment and media and health and wellness companies. Previous recipient of the Los Angeles Chamber of Commerce Employee Champion For Life Work Harmony Award and named a “Best Places to Work” by the Los Angeles Business Journal eight times since 2008, GHJ is passionate about helping clients and its people #BeMore by focusing on building thriving businesses and creating a better future.

GHJ works as a business advocate for its clients — providing personalized service and building long-term relationships to help position our clients for growth. Through its affiliation with HLB International, a global network of independent professional accounting firms and business advisers, GHJ is able to partner with other top firms across major cities throughout the U.S. and the world. GHJ’s audit, tax and advisory teams leverage the HLB network to better serve its clients and give clients access to member firms in over 158 countries across the globe and over 775 offices worldwide.

Also ranked as a top-20 largest accounting firm on the Los Angeles Business Journal’s Book of Lists, GHJ has 15 partners and more than 160 staff members that serve over 3,000 clients. GHJ is a member of the American Institute of Certified Public Accountants (AICPA), the AICPA Governmental Audit Quality Center (GAQC), the California Society of CPAs and the California Association of Nonprofits (CalNonprofit).
